Article : JC steps in to clean up Kardashian mess
[...]
When the group was escorted out of Boudoir, JC Chasez, former member of N’Sync, stepped in to help clean up the mess although he had no prior involvement with the scuffle.
“After the bouncers step in to drag them out, somehow a waitress got in the middle of it and got knocked on the floor and JC Chasez, [who was there separately from Rob], obviously felt really bad for her and went over to pick her up and make sure she was OK.” [source]
